Appropriate Storage Conditions for Unopened Brown Rice

Brown rice is an excellent source of nutrition, and it can last for a long time if stored properly. To ensure that unopened brown rice remains fresh and safe to consume, it should be stored in a cool, dry place. The ideal temperature range for storing brown rice is between 40-50°F (4-10°C). If the temperature is too warm, the rice will spoil faster. Additionally, it should be kept in a sealed container or bag to prevent moisture from getting inside and spoiling the rice. It is also important to keep brown rice away from direct sunlight and away from other food items that could produce odors or humidity.

When stored properly in a cool, dry area in an airtight container, unopened brown rice will stay fresh for up to six months. After this time period, it is still safe to eat but may not have its original flavor or texture. Tips to Maximize the Shelf Life of Unopened Brown Rice

Brown rice is a staple food that provides a variety of essential nutrients, making it an important part of a healthy diet. It is also relatively easy to store and can last for quite some time if stored correctly. Here are some tips to maximize the shelf life of unopened brown rice:

  • Store unopened brown rice in an airtight container or resealable bag. This will help keep out any moisture and contaminants, which can cause the rice to spoil.
  • Keep your brown rice in a cool, dry place such as a cupboard or pantry. Avoid areas with high humidity as this can cause the grains to spoil more quickly.
  • If you are storing large quantities of brown rice, consider keeping it in the refrigerator or freezer. This will help extend the shelf life by several months.
  • Check your brown rice regularly for signs of spoilage. If you notice any changes in color, odor, or texture, discard the product immediately.

By following these tips, you can ensure that your unopened brown rice stays fresh and lasts longer. Storing your brown rice correctly is key to maintaining its nutritional value and extending its shelf life.
